show ipv6 pim neighbor
Use the show ipv6 pim neighbor command to display IPv6 PIMSM neighbors
learned on the routing interfaces.
Syntax
show ipv6 pim neighbor [interface vlan
vlan-id
]
vlan-id
A valid VLAN ID value.
Default Configuration
There is no default configuration for this command.
Command Mode
Privileged Exec mode, Configuration mode and all Configuration submodes
User Guidelines
If a VLAN interface is not specified, all neighbors are shown.
Example
console#show ipv6 pim neighbor
